What companies run services between Alicante Central Bus Station, Spain and Porto, Portugal?

Ryanair, Iberia, and two other airlines fly from Alicante-Elche Airport (ALC) to Francisco De Sá Carneiro Airport (OPO) 4 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Estación de Autobuses de Alicante/Alacant to Porto - Terminal Intermodal de Campanhã via Estación Sur de Autobuses in around 11h 55m.
